Where Were Indo-European Languages Historically Spoken Outside Their Core Range?

šŸ’” The Answer

  • Indo-European languages were historically spoken in Anatolia (modern Turkey).
  • They were also spoken in Northwestern China.
  • These regions lie outside the core areas of Europe, Iran, and India.
  • The Anatolian branch is now extinct, including languages like Hittite.
  • The Tocharian branch, though not explicitly tied to China, is another extinct branch spoken in Central Asia.
